Origins
The Yorkshire Terrier is a breed that originated in Yorkshire, England. The breed was developed during the Victorian time period by crossing breeding various terriers including the Manchester Terrier and Skye Terrier. Paisley and Clydesdale Terriers were also utilized. Low blood sugar or hypoglycemia is among the most common health problems in Yorkies. The condition is more likely to affect puppies up to 4 months of age but it can occur at any point in their lives. The condition can cause weakness, dizziness, drooling, and other symptoms, but it can be treated by supplying regular small meals and administering glucose supplements.
Another health issue that is commonly observed in Yorkies is tracheal collapsing, that can be caused by weakening of the rings that support the windpipe. It's more prevalent in small breeds such as the Duxi yorkshire biewer kaufen Terrier and can cause breathing difficulties, a humming cough and other signs. The condition is usually caused by breathing too hard and can be treated with a humidifier, medicine or hot water bottle, and suzie der yorkie-welpe making sure your dog is kept out of cold or warm weather. Chronic or severe cases might require treatment with surgery.
Other health concerns for the breed include mouth and dental problems, specifically periodontal and gingivitis. This is due to the smaller mouths of these dogs, which could result in food bacteria, minerals and food particles being incapable of being cleaned effectively. Regular dental care at home, including cleaning and brushing, along with professional vet treatment, prevention and maintenance, can lower these risks.
